About This Item

Matthew Marks Gallery, 2002. 1st Edition 1st Printing. Soft cover. As New/No Jacket, As Issued . First Edition. Soft cover in clamshell case with a magnetic closure, 12.5 x 11.25 in., 120 pages with over 70 full color plates. As new. Signed in black marker on title page by Brice Marden.
